K9DX wrote:
 >7. If you want better signal to noise, reduce the beam-width. Going from 
15 to 30db off the sides or back, won't do much.

	Do you feel this applies to staggered/phased Beverages
(i.e.echelon)?  My greatest noise problem is often thunderstorms
from the South-Central US when trying to listen toward Europe.
I've been considering staggered/phased Beverages as a solution
and believe this should help greatly.  Even if individual Beverage
F/R patterns are not great, the result of a phased/staggered pair
should work fairly well IMHO.  Any thoughts on this?
